I am still in progress with my rebuild on the 1869 washer however as i have pulled all 3 machines i have down from the shed. I am thinking of working on the 2169 next. I believe there may be something wrong with its timer however as it doesnt seem to advance (i have not really looked into it) I am looking to rebuild that machine still however one thing i was wondering is it possible to modify it so the spin speed is faster? i suspect if the pulley on the motor is changed out for a larger pulley perhaps from an old basket drive assembly i am removing from the current build.

My thoughts however are this will likely put extra load on the motor.
